Best Ever M&M Brownies
ByIngredients
- 1 cup butter melted
- 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 ¼ cup packed brown sugar
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 4 eggs
- 1 ¼ cup flour
- ⅔ cup M&Ms
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350
- Line 9X13 baking pan with foil and spray foil with cooking spray
- In a large bowl, combine butter and cocoa. Mix well
- Add sugars and salt. Mix well
- Add eggs. One at a time and mix well each time in between eggs. Do not add all at once, and really mix well. You don’t want a bite of chocolate cooked egg bit. Gross!
- Add flour. Mix well
- Gently stir in M&Ms
- Bake 30-35 min until the edges pull away slightly from the pan and center is done.
